The close_diff_in_min and close_in_min values are empty

Infos:

  • Used Zammad version: 6.5
  • Used Zammad installation type: Package
  • Operating system: Ubuntu
  • Browser + version: Version 137.0.7151.120 (Official Build) (64-bit)

Expected behavior:

  • After closed the ticket the close_diff_in_min and close_in_diff values are need to captured in the database table

Actual behavior:

  • After closed the ticket the close_diff_in_min and close_in_diff values are not captured in the database table

Steps to reproduce the behavior:

Hi pugazhenthi.r,

this is a normal behavior when you haven’t set a SLA for these tickets. Please have a look
to our documentation. In the description there is a hint called [SLA] when this field is only filled
when the ticket has a matching SLA.

Hopefully i could bring light in this mystery.
